Ingredients

Gather these simple ingredients to create your delectable Caramel Apple Cheesecake Bars. Using quality ingredients ensures the best flavor and texture in your finished dessert.

For the Crust:

  • All-purpose flour: 2 cups
  • Packed brown sugar: 1/2 cup
  • Cold butter: 2 sticks (1 cup)

For the Cream Cheese Filling:

  • Cream cheese, softened: 2 (8 oz) packages
  • Granulated sugar: 1/2 cup
  • Large eggs: 2
  • Vanilla extract: 1 teaspoon

For the Apple Layer:

  • Granny Smith apples, peeled, cored, finely chopped: 3 large
  • Granulated sugar: 2 tablespoons
  • Ground cinnamon: 1/2 teaspoon
  • Ground nutmeg: 1/4 teaspoon

For the Streusel Topping:

  • Packed brown sugar: 1 cup
  • All-purpose flour: 1 cup
  • Quick-cooking oats: 1/2 cup
  • Cold butter: 1 stick (1/2 cup)

For Drizzling:

  • Caramel topping: 1/2 cup

Notes & Substitutions

Ensure your butter and cream cheese are softened to room temperature for a smooth, lump-free filling and a properly crumbly streusel. For the apple layer, feel free to use other tart varieties like Honeycrisp or Braeburn for a slightly different flavor profile. If you need a gluten-free option, use a 1:1 gluten-free all-purpose flour blend in both the crust and streusel. Any good quality store-bought or homemade caramel sauce works perfectly for drizzling over these rich caramel apple cheesecake bars.

Instructions: How to Make Caramel Apple Cheesecake Bars

Follow these step-by-step instructions to bake your perfect Caramel Apple Cheesecake Bars. This detailed guide makes the process simple and enjoyable, even for beginners.

Prep Work

First, pre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Next, line a 9×13 inch baking pan with heavy-duty aluminum foil, ensuring you leave an overhang on the sides. This overhang creates “handles” for easy removal of the baked bars later.

Make the Shortbread Crust

In a medium bowl, combine 2 cups of all-purpose flour and 1/2 cup of packed brown sugar. Add 2 sticks of cold butter, cut into small pieces. Use a pastry blender, a fork, or your fingertips to cut the butter into the flour mixture until it resembles coarse crumbs. Press this mixture evenly into the bottom of your prepared baking pan. Bake the crust for 15 minutes, or until it appears lightly browned around the edges.

Prepare the Cream Cheese Filling

While the crust is still warm, prepare the rich cream cheese filling. In a large bowl, use an electric mixer to beat the softened cream cheese with 1/2 cup of granulated sugar until the mixture is smooth and creamy. Next, add the two large eggs, one at a time, beating well after each addition until just combined. Stir in the vanilla extract. Pour this smooth cream cheese filling evenly over the warm, baked shortbread crust.

Layer the Apples

In a small bowl, combine the finely chopped Granny Smith apples with the remaining 2 tablespoons of granulated sugar, 1/2 teaspoon of ground cinnamon, and 1/4 teaspoon of ground nutmeg. Toss everything together until the apples are well coated with the spices and sugar. Carefully spoon the apple mixture evenly over the cream cheese layer in the pan.

Create the Streusel Topping

Now, make the delicious streusel topping for your Caramel Apple Cheesecake Bars. In a separate small bowl, combine 1 cup of packed brown sugar, 1 cup of all-purpose flour, and 1/2 cup of quick-cooking oats. Quick-cooking oats are favored in many baking recipes because they contribute to a finer texture and act as a binding agent. Add 1 stick of softened butter, cut into small pieces. Use a pastry blender or your fingers to cut the butter into the dry ingredients until the mixture forms coarse crumbs. Sprinkle this streusel topping evenly over the apple layer in the baking pan.

Bake and Finish

Place the pan back into the preheated oven and bake for 30 minutes, or until the cream cheese filling appears set and the streusel topping is golden brown. Remove the pan from the oven and place it on a wire rack to cool completely at room temperature. Once cooled, transfer the pan to the refrigerator and chill the bars thoroughly for at least 4 hours, or preferably overnight. Before serving, lift the bars out of the pan using the foil handles. Drizzle generously with 1/2 cup of caramel topping. Finally, cut the chilled block into 2 dozen beautiful Caramel Apple Cheesecake Bars.

Pro Tips for Perfect Caramel Apple Cheesecake Bars

Mastering your Caramel Apple Cheesecake Bars involves a few simple tricks. These tips ensure your dessert turns out perfectly every time, even for beginner bakers.

  • Ensure ingredients are room temperature: Softened cream cheese and butter blend smoothly, preventing lumps in your filling and streusel.
  • Avoid over-mixing cheesecake batter: Overmixing incorporates too much air, which can lead to cracks in your cheesecake as it cools.
  • Chill bars completely for clean cuts: This step is crucial for firm, neat slices and to allow the layers to fully set.
  • Use heavy-duty foil for easy lifting: The sturdy foil prevents tearing when you remove the entire slab of bars from the pan.
  • Choose firm, tart apples: Many chefs agree that Granny Smith apples are prized for their tart flavor and ability to hold their texture when baked, providing the perfect tangy contrast to the sweet cheesecake and caramel.

Storage Instructions

Store any leftover Caramel Apple Cheesecake Bars in an airtight container. Keep them refrigerated for up to 5 days, ensuring they stay fresh and delicious. For longer storage, freeze individual bars by wrapping them tightly in plastic wrap and then placing them in a freezer-safe container for up to 2 months. Thaw in the refrigerator before serving.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Here are some common questions about making and enjoying this delicious Caramel Apple Cheesecake Bars Recipe.

  • What type of apples are best? Granny Smith apples are highly recommended due to their firm texture and tartness, which perfectly balances the sweetness of the bars.
  • Can I make these bars ahead of time? Absolutely, these bars are a perfect make-ahead dessert; chilling them overnight allows all the flavors to meld beautifully.
  • How do I prevent my cheesecake from cracking? Use room temperature ingredients, avoid overmixing the batter, and allow the bars to cool gradually to prevent cracking.
  • Can I use a different size baking pan? You can, but you’ll need to adjust the baking time accordingly and the thickness of the layers will change. A 9×13 pan is ideal for this recipe.
  • How do I freeze these bars? Wrap each cooled bar individually in plastic wrap, then store them in an airtight freezer-safe container or bag for best results.
